Williamson sits on some of the toughest soil in Georgia—that dense red clay drainage is notorious for creating boggy patches and uneven settling. If you've ever tried to keep natural grass healthy here, you know exactly what we mean. Artificial turf solves that problem completely. Red clay doesn't drain well on its own, so we remove the top layer and replace it with engineered base material that prevents pooling and settling. This is non-negotiable in Williamson—we've seen installations fail because contractors tried to save money by skipping it. Proper base work means your turf surface stays level and functional for 10+ years.
Pricing depends on square footage, base prep scope, and whether you need drainage solutions. A small retail lot (2,000–3,000 sq ft) typically runs $8,000–$15,000 installed. Larger properties or heavy clay removal can cost more. We'll quote your specific site after a walkthrough—no guessing.
